9200A Dual Amplifier
The 9200A Dual Amplifier is a versatile, high-performance dual-channel amplifier from Tabor Electronics, designed for applications requiring high-voltage, wide-bandwidth signal amplification. Compact yet powerful, the 9200A delivers up to 400Vp-p per channel and continuous current of 100mA, ensuring precise signal integrity across laboratory, industrial, and MEMS testing applications.
Dual-Channel Precision Amplification
Each independent channel provides bipolar amplification with a fixed gain of x50, ideal for driving signals from waveform, function, or pulse generators. The rear-panel monitor outputs divide the main output by 100, allowing safe low-voltage monitoring without compromising signal quality.
Unipolar Mode for Specialized Applications
A unique feature of the 9200A is its unipolar mode, designed specifically for MEMS engine actuators or other applications requiring conversion from bipolar to unipolar signals. In this mode, a single input can be split into two precise output channels, enabling accurate control of up/down and left/right actuators.
Wide Bandwidth and Slew Rate
With full power bandwidth from DC to over 500 kHz and a high slew rate of 400V/µs, the 9200A ensures rapid, low-distortion signal amplification even with capacitive loads up to 1nF. This makes it ideal for high-speed signal testing and precision laboratory experiments.
Safety and Compact Design
Safety is prioritized in the 9200A with a front panel mechanical switch and protective latch preventing accidental high-voltage application. The amplifier only activates after the safety latch is lifted and the high-voltage switch is turned on. Its compact 2U chassis allows bench-top placement or standard 19″ rack mounting, saving valuable space while maintaining durability.

Technical Specifications
| Specification | Details |
| Model | 9200A-50 |
| Type | Dual-Channel Signal Amplifier |
| Voltage Output | 400Vp-p (±200V) per channel |
| Output Current | 100 mA per channel |
| Full Power Bandwidth | DC to >500 kHz |
| Slew Rate | 400 V/µs |
| Gain | Fixed x50 (custom gain available) |
| Signal Modes | Bipolar, Unipolar (MEMS) |
| Monitor Outputs | Rear-panel, divided by 100 |
| Size | 2U, half-rack, bench-top compatible |
| Mounting Options | S-Rack, D-Rack, Professional Case Kit |
| Target Applications | High-voltage waveform amplification, MEMS actuator control |
